Code P06DD 2015 GMC Sierra Description

The P06DD diagnostic trouble code (DTC) indicates a performance issue with the engine oil pressure control solenoid valve in a 2015 GMC Sierra. This solenoid is responsible for regulating the flow of oil to the engine's hydraulic system, which is crucial for maintaining optimal oil pressure. The engine control module (ECM) monitors the performance of the oil pressure control solenoid to ensure that the engine operates efficiently and effectively. When the ECM detects that the solenoid is not functioning within the expected parameters, it triggers the P06DD code.

Common Causes of P06DD 2015 GMC Sierra

  1. Faulty Oil Pressure Control Solenoid: The solenoid itself may be malfunctioning due to wear or internal failure.
  2. Clogged Oil Filter: A clogged filter can restrict oil flow, affecting the solenoid's ability to regulate pressure.
  3. Low Oil Level: Insufficient oil levels can lead to inadequate lubrication and pressure regulation.
  4. Oil Contamination: Contaminants in the oil, such as dirt or metal shavings, can impede the solenoid's function.
  5. Wiring Issues: Damaged or corroded wiring and connectors associated with the solenoid can disrupt its operation.

Symptoms of P06DD 2015 GMC Sierra

  1. Low Oil Pressure Warning Light: The dashboard may display a warning light indicating low oil pressure.
  2. Engine Noise: Increased engine noise, particularly from the valve train, due to insufficient lubrication.
  3. Poor Engine Performance: Noticeable decrease in engine power, acceleration, and overall responsiveness.
  4. Oil Leaks: Potential oil leaks around the solenoid or oil filter area, indicating a failure in the oil delivery system.
  5. Check Engine Light: The check engine light may illuminate, prompting further diagnostics.

How to Fix P06DD 2015 GMC Sierra

  1. Diagnostic Testing: Begin with a thorough diagnostic to confirm the P06DD code and check for any additional codes that may provide insight into the issue.
  2. Visual Inspection: Inspect the oil pressure control solenoid and associated wiring for signs of damage, corrosion, or disconnection.
  3. Oil Change: If the oil is contaminated or low, perform an oil change and replace the oil filter to ensure proper flow and lubrication.
  4. Replace the Solenoid: If the solenoid is found to be faulty, replace it with a new, OEM-quality part to restore proper function.
  5. Clear Codes and Test Drive: After repairs, clear the diagnostic codes and perform a test drive to ensure that the issue has been resolved and that the check engine light does not reappear.

Cost to Fix P06DD 2015 GMC Sierra

The typical repair costs for addressing a P06DD code can vary widely based on the specific diagnosis and repairs needed. On average, you might expect to pay between $200 and $600 for parts and labor. This estimate includes the cost of the oil change, oil filter, and replacement of the solenoid if necessary.

Tech Notes for P06DD 2015 GMC Sierra

Inspect the Oil Pressure Control Solenoid Valve from the oil pump. Inspect for the end of the solenoid to be broken off. If a broken solenoid is found replace the oil pump and check the OCV before installing the new oil pump.
